Stone Driveway Construction in Salt Lake City, UT
Stone driveway construction involves designing and installing durable, attractive driveways using natural or manufactured stone materials. This service covers a variety of projects, including creating new driveways, replacing existing surfaces, or expanding current driveways to accommodate more vehicles.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of stone options available, such as flagstone, cobblestone, or crushed stone, as well as the benefits of each in terms of durability and appearance. Additionally, considerations like driveway size, slope, drainage, and the overall style of the property are important factors to discuss before beginning a project.
Homeowners interested in stone driveway construction often seek information about the installation process, maintenance requirements, and how the chosen materials will complement their property’s landscape. It’s helpful to consider the expected traffic load, weather conditions, and long-term upkeep when selecting a stone type and design. Understanding these aspects can ensure the driveway not only enhances curb appeal but also provides a functional and lasting surface for years to come.

Stone Driveway Construction Questions
What types of stone are suitable for driveways? Common options include granite, limestone, and flagstone, chosen for durability and appearance.
How long does a stone driveway typ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, stone driveways can last several decades.
Can stone driveways be installed on uneven ground? Yes, but the surface may require grading or base adjustments for stability.
What maintenance is needed for a stone driveway? Regular cleaning and sealing help preserve the appearance and prevent damage over time.
